# Break-Glass: Catalog Cache Invalidation

Scope: the Pinrow product catalog at Veldstone Retail. If stale prices persist after a purge and the Hollowmere invalidation queue is wedged, use break-glass to flush the edge tier directly. Contractors: get verbal sign-off from the catalog lead first. Steps: open the Hollowmere admin shell, select emergency-flush, confirm the tenant, and run it once — repeated flushes thrash the origin. Access is logged and expires after 20 minutes. Unseal the admin shell with the passphrase below.

recovery phrase for kahop-tajog: istix-casvan

Minutes — Management Meeting, Harrowfield Office

Present: T. Veslin (Ops), M. Okendo (Finance), R. Pratch (Legal).

The committee reviewed the renegotiation of the Corvane Park lease. Landlord representatives proposed a seven-year extension with stepped increases; Finance modelled a counter at five years with a break clause. Legal flagged the reinstatement obligations as the main exposure. Action: Okendo to prepare revised terms sheet before the next session. For the incoming director's awareness, the strategic rationale is set out below.

board note of yadup-fajef: Druiusox Holdings is in early talks to buy Norwynek Systems for about $186.0 million. The Kaseth launch date is June 24, and nothing goes to the press before then. Legal wants the Quenethek Group term sheet withdrawn before November 27.

Hey — handing off the undo/redo stack in Linograph before I'm out. The review branch reworks command coalescing: drag operations now merge into one undo step, and redo invalidation happens on any new mutation, not just geometry edits. Watch the snapshot diffing in history_core, that's where the subtle bugs live. One admin thing: the test fixtures live in the sealed Quillan vault, and unlocking it prompts for the team recovery passphrase. Putting it right below so review isn't blocked.

vault phrase of tajop-haduf = holath-brivan-wenax

# Break-Glass Access — Crumbcart Restock Planner

The Crumbcart vending-machine restock planner runs on the Pellworth cluster with no standing admin accounts. If the scheduler deadlocks and route exports stall, break-glass access is the only path to the planner's config store. Use it sparingly: every invocation pages the on-call rotation and opens an audit ticket reviewed at the weekly sync. To unlock the break-glass console, enter the recovery passphrase shown directly below.

vault phrase of tajef-tafog = istox-sorax-zorox-casok-holox-kelix-weneth-drueth-casion